Ormai non più ma fino a tre anni fa il tennis era l’unico sport nel quale una partita poteva non finire mai. E in effetti c’è stata una partita che è andata avanti a oltranza, è stata giocata a Wimbledon, nel 2010, al primo turno, da John Isner e Nicolas Mahut, ed è durata tre giorni.
